css中div的高度是用百分比设置的,怎样让div内的元素垂直居中?1、用一个“ghost”伪元素(看不见的伪元素)和 inline-block / vertical-align 可以搞定居中,非常巧妙 。但是这个方法要求待居中的元素是 inline-block,不是一个真正通用的方案 。
2、设置行高要注意父容器高度和子元素line-height一样的数值,内容中的行内元素就会垂直居中 。
3、以下是让div中的内容垂直居中的具体操作方法:首先我们准备好一个空的html结构的文档 。接下来我们要准备的是准备一个div用来放内容了,这里为了显示特意给div设置了边框 。
4、方法一:让一个DIV水平居中,直接用CSS就可以做到 。只要设置了DIV的宽度,然后使用margin设置边距0 auto , CSS自动算出左右边距,使得DIV居中 。
5、CSS实现水平垂直居中对齐在CSS中实现水平居中,会比较简单 。
CSS3如何固定图片宽度使图片高度按图片比例自适应?使用img标签,给它的width属性设定一个绝对数量值,其高度就会自动按照width的值进行缩放了 。
宽度和高度不要同时设置,只需要设置一个,另一个就会自动按照图片的原始比例进行缩放,从而使图片不会发生变形 。
自适应显示宽度代码方法:首先,在网页代码的头部 , 加入一行viewport元标签 。
把背景图片扩展至最大尺寸,以使其宽度和高度完全适应容器区域(容器的部分边角位置可能会留空)需要注意的是,background-size是css3的属性 , 浏览器必须支持css3才能看到预期的效果 。
在CSS3中常用的几种颜色渐变模式1、CSS3 渐变(gradients)可以让你在两个或多个指定的颜色之间显示平稳的过渡 。
2、CSS3里面的线性渐变:linear-gradient 语法 参数 第一个参数:指定渐变方向,可以用“角度”的关键词或“英文”来表示:第一个参数省略时,默认为“180deg”,等同于“to bottom” 。
3、采用svg模式 实现原理:程序先计算字体所在容器的高度N,然后清空空容器的内容,加上N个跨度,每个跨度都是原容器的文本 。根据渐变颜色计算每个区间的颜色,每个区间中的文本定位比上一个区间高一个像素 。
4、css字体渐变 , css是怎么定义字体有渐变颜色的?1 。创建一个新的html文件,并将其命名为test.html 。在test.html文件中,使用字体标签创建三行文本 , 并以不同的方式设置字体的颜色 。
CSS系列篇:CSS3的常见属性1、属性:background-position 取值: 属性:background-size 取值: 属性:background-origin 取值: 属性:background-clip 取值: CSS3多背景通过为每个背景属性提供多个属性值实现 。
2、【相关视频教程:CSS3教程】css3的动画属性animation-name属性animation-name属性:定义动画名称,用于指定由规则定义的动画的一个或多个名称 。
3、css3新属性:RGBA和透明度 RGBA是RGB色彩模型的一个扩展 。
4、CSS部分 背景图片分辨率为427*640 分别给box的background-size属性添加不同的属性值 , 会产生不同的效果 。长度 :可以用px、em、rem等指定背景图片大小,不能为负值 。
5、float,css的一种属性 , 主要属性值为:left(左浮动)、none(不浮动)、right(右浮动)、inherit(继承父元素浮动),多用于网页排版 。float属性定义元素在哪个方向浮动 。
当前元素设置display:flex后,当前元素设置height:100%无效怎么办_百度...display:block生成一个块元素盒 。display:flex的行为类似于块元件(blockelement)和根据本flexbox模型布置出其含量 。
这是因为里面这个table的上级元素也就是td并没有指定高度(尽管tr指定了400px的高度,但对td没用的 , 这就是为什么table现在已不再用于页面布局的原因),这样height的100%就缺少了参照物,所以无效 。
当设计一个页面时 , 你在里面放置了一个div元素,你希望它占满整个窗口高度,最自然的做法,你会给这个div添加height:100%;的css属性 。
, 当一层flex布局的时候 , 设置子元素的width:100%就没有问题;效果如下:2,当页面中多层flex布局嵌套的时候 , 设置其中子元素的width:100%会不起作用 。
第一种方法:此时对.son1设置width: 100%无效,但是设置width: 0可行 。即:.son1{ flex: 1; width: 0} 如果不设置宽度,.son1可以被子节点无限撑开 。第二种方法:增加 overflow: hidden 。
可惜的是浏览器一般默认解释为内容的高度,而不是100% 。
div高度设置100%不生效问题1、或者问题为如何设置div高度等于视口高度 。前端高度问题一直是个坑 , 只要是子元素的排版一定要求要有宽高,但是body没有宽高这种说法 。你还不能给它固定设置,因为不同屏幕的宽高不一样,只能用JavaScript获取宽高设置 。
2、是起作用的!用百分比做属性值时,一定要注意的是:百分比是相对于其父级元素的 。你的这个就现对于:td class=tagTD的高度了 。
3、要响应式 , 也就是拖动窗口大小,栅格里面的div、图片等跟着变化 。但存在一个限制,因为div内的动画,初始化时必须要指定一个高度,不指定的话就默认为0,那就显示不了动画了 。
【css3高度100,html高度100%】css3高度100的介绍就聊到这里吧 , 感谢你花时间阅读本站内容 , 更多关于html高度100%、css3高度100的信息别忘了在本站进行查找喔 。
推荐阅读
- 我在操场上玩游戏动作很快,我在操场上运动
- 易语言抓取数据传给php 易语言调用php
- 系统盘怎么更换固态硬盘,如何更换系统固态硬盘
- mysql分区表添加分区,mysql建立分区表
- vb.net按下回车 vb中按下回车键后发生
- 获得用户注册java代码,获得用户注册java代码是什么
- 路由器显示网络弱怎么回事,路由器显示网络出现问题
- 如何下载课本的pdf,怎么下载课本
- 打开linux命令 如何打开linux命令行